Judgement and Enforcement

Judgement

There are considerations to be made when considering obtaining a judgement.  Judgement will:

  • Affect the debtor's credit rating
  • Remain on the public record for 6 years (unless paid within 28 days)

 

Options for Enforcement

Once you have obtained a judgement you have the following options:

  • Warrant of Execution - This will enable you to seize and sell the debtor's moveable property
  • Information Order - Forces the debtor to reveal more about their financial status
  • Third Party Debt Order - Doing this will mean a debt due to the debtor will be paid to you instead
  • Charging Order - Take a charge over the debtor's premises / buildings
  • Attachment of Earnings Order - Have the debt paid directly from the debtor's earnings
  • Bankruptcy - Start Insolvency proceedings against the debtor
